  1. Waimānalo (Hawaiian pronunciation: [vɐjmaːˈnɐlo]) is a census-designated place (CDP) in the District of Koʻolaupoko, in the City & County of Honolulu, on the island of Oʻahu, Hawaii, United States. This small windward community is located near the eastern end of the island.

  2. Nov 7, 2022 · Waimānalo is a small rural community on the eastern side of Oahu, extending from the ridge behind Keolu Hills by Makapu‘u and ending near the Olomana Golf Club. A single two-lane highway—Kalaniana‘ole Highway—runs through this coastal town.
